Key Insights

The global elastic joint sealant market is experiencing robust growth, driven by the increasing demand for construction and infrastructure development worldwide. The market, valued at approximately $5 billion in 2025, is projected to exhibit a healthy Compound Annual Growth Rate (CAGR) of around 6% from 2025 to 2033, reaching an estimated market size of approximately $8 billion by 2033. Key drivers include the rising preference for sustainable and eco-friendly building materials, the growing need for effective waterproofing solutions in diverse climates, and the expansion of the residential and commercial construction sectors, particularly in developing economies. Market segmentation reveals significant opportunities in both one-component and two-component sealants, with the two-component segment expected to maintain a larger market share due to its superior performance characteristics. Applications in commercial construction are anticipated to drive substantial growth, fueled by large-scale infrastructure projects and renovations. However, factors like fluctuating raw material prices and stringent environmental regulations pose challenges to market expansion. Major players, including Henkel, Sika, and W. R. Meadows, are focusing on innovation, strategic partnerships, and expansion into emerging markets to maintain a competitive edge. Regional analysis indicates strong growth potential in Asia-Pacific and North America, driven by robust construction activities and favorable economic conditions.

Challenges and Restraints in the Elastic Joint Sealant Market

Despite the positive growth outlook, the elastic joint sealant market faces certain challenges. Fluctuations in raw material prices, particularly those of polymers and other essential components, can significantly impact production costs and profitability. This price volatility can affect the overall market dynamics and lead to price fluctuations for end consumers. Economic downturns and fluctuations in construction activity can negatively impact demand, leading to decreased sales and market slowdown. Competition among numerous players in the market, including both established giants and emerging companies, can lead to price wars and pressure on profit margins. The availability of cheaper, albeit lower-quality, alternatives can also pose a challenge to manufacturers of premium elastic joint sealants. Furthermore, strict environmental regulations concerning volatile organic compounds (VOCs) and other harmful emissions require manufacturers to develop and utilize environmentally friendly sealant formulations, adding to production costs and complexity. Difficulties in maintaining a consistent supply chain, especially during periods of global instability, can also create disruptions and impact overall market stability. Finally, the need for skilled labor for proper application of these sealants represents a potential barrier to wider adoption, especially in regions with limited skilled workforce availability.

Key Region or Country & Segment to Dominate the Market

The commercial segment is projected to dominate the elastic joint sealant market due to the substantial scale of construction projects undertaken within this sector. Large-scale commercial buildings, infrastructure developments (e.g., bridges, tunnels), and industrial facilities require significant quantities of high-performance sealants to ensure structural integrity, weather resistance, and overall building longevity.

  • North America and Europe are expected to retain significant market share, driven by robust construction activity, stringent building codes, and a high level of awareness regarding the importance of quality building materials.
  • Asia-Pacific, particularly countries like China and India, are projected to witness substantial growth due to rapid urbanization, significant infrastructure investments, and a booming construction industry. This region's growth is expected to be significant, driven by large-scale infrastructure projects.
  • The two-component segment is likely to experience growth, although at a potentially slower pace than one-component sealants. Two-component sealants, while offering superior performance, require more specialized application skills and are generally more expensive. This necessitates a skilled workforce and influences market penetration.
  • One-component sealants will retain a larger market share due to their ease of application, cost-effectiveness, and suitability for a broader range of applications, appealing to both professional contractors and DIY consumers.

The sheer volume of commercial projects, coupled with the increasing need for long-lasting, high-performance sealants, makes this sector the primary driver for market growth. While the residential segment shows growth, the scale of projects and the consequent demand for sealant volume in the commercial sector is significantly larger.
